Transaction 5edcc815e2f232c6642a900a2658a9702e98a0f33caba98a0c3b20e194d1b1ff

block
f8accca4f1cdc8452bec0ae11bc5072f68d86328aae68279f12b4a70a5f94e2f

3 Inputs

983 Outputs